University College Lillebælt (Denmark)
University College Lillebaelt offers higher education programmes that contribute to the continual development of the welfare society. We train social educators, teachers, nurses, radiographers, physiotherapists, occupational therapists, biomedical laboratory scientists, public administrators and social workers.
University College Lillebaelt is one of seven university colleges in Denmark. Geographically, University College Lillebaelt covers a part of the Southern Region of Denmark and has approximately 7,000 students and 700 employees. In addition, University College Lillebaelt offers Continuing Professional Development, from one-day seminars tailored to specific organisations and professionals to Diplomas at the BA-level. The Bachelor of Education Programme is offered at campuses in Jelling and Odense, and a prospective exchange student has several options.
